Foshan Launches China’s First Fully Automated Humanoid Robot Production Line

by Ava Thompson
June 25, 2026
in China, Foshan
Foshan launches China’s first automated humanoid robot line – Macao News
Share on FacebookShare on Twitter

Foshan, a city at the forefront of technological innovation in southern China, has made headlines with the launch of the nation’s first automated humanoid robot production line. This groundbreaking initiative, reported by Macao News, underscores China’s commitment to advancing its manufacturing capabilities through cutting-edge robotics and artificial intelligence. As industries across the globe increasingly pivot towards automation, Foshan’s ambition to spearhead this transformation positions the city as a pivotal player in the rapidly evolving landscape of smart manufacturing. With this state-of-the-art facility, the region aims not only to enhance efficiency and production rates but also to redefine the role of robotics in everyday life, setting the stage for a new era in technology-driven economic development.

Foshan Unveils Pioneering Automated Humanoid Robot Production Line

In a groundbreaking development for the robotics industry, Foshan has launched China’s first fully automated production line for humanoid robots. This state-of-the-art facility showcases a fusion of advanced robotics, artificial intelligence, and efficient manufacturing processes. The production line is designed to enhance the capabilities of humanoid robots while ensuring rapid scalability and cost-effectiveness in meeting market demands. Key features of this pioneering initiative include:

  • Robust Automation: Integration of robotics in all production stages.
  • Precision Engineering: Advanced machinery ensuring high quality and consistency.
  • AI Integration: Intelligent systems for adaptive production cycles.
  • Sustainability Focus: Energy-efficient operations and waste reduction practices.

This development is expected to position Foshan as a leader in the global robotics landscape, fostering innovation and job creation. The production line will not only meet domestic needs but also cater to international markets, addressing widespread applications ranging from healthcare to education. A comparative analysis of production capacities illustrates the potential impact of this venture:

Feature Current Production Capacity Projected Capacity Post-Implementation
Monthly Output 500 units 2000 units
Workforce Required 30 employees 15 employees (automated)
Energy Consumption 150 kWh 70 kWh (optimized)
